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the St. Joseph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the St. Joseph Cemetery:
41.5870, -83.1646
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the St. Joseph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The St. Joseph Cemetery is located in Ottawa County<2>.
The county seat for Ottawa County is located in Port Clinton. Port Clinton lies 12 miles [19.3 km]<3> to the east southeast of the St. Joseph Cemetery .

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#1045334 (Saint Joseph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#1045334 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Ottawa
- Est. Elev: 175 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Oak Harbor
- Location given for Saint Joseph Cemetery:
- Lat: 41.5869934 Lon: -83.1646447
